TOPFLOOR The ideal low shrinkage flooring solution

BENEFITS Sustainable Compared to traditional steel mesh or steel fibre reinforced concrete, TOPFLOOR can reduce CO 2 emissions by up to 20%. Reduced thickness Its enhanced flexural strength enables the installation of a more efficient flooring section. Less joints Saw joints can be spaced out to 20m x 20m without the requirement for steel. Ease TOPFLOOR can be placed using conventional laserscreed methods and traditional finishing processes. Faster working Time is saved through early powertrowelling and joint cutting, while high compressive strength means slab loading can begin at just 14 days. Durable TOPFLOOR is highly durable without surface treatment, achieving BS-8204 standard.

Cost-effective Less material usage, high surface durability and lower maintenance costs can significantly reduce whole life costs. DURABILITY TOPFLOOR provides superior flexural and compressive strength without the need for steel reinforcement. HOW IT WORKS TOPFLOOR is a low shrinkage concrete for use in ground bearing slabs. Extremely durable, with very high abrasion and impact resistance, it provides superior flexural and compressive strength, without the need for steel or mesh reinforcement. Reduces shrinkage, time and costs The mechanical and shrinkage properties of TOPFLOOR enable the design of thinner and unreinforced slabs, with increased joint spacing at 20mx20m (400m²). Construction can be shortened through early power-trowelling and joint cutting, while slabs can be loaded from just 14 days. The drastic reduction of joints, limited curling and high surface durability combine to deliver substantial savings in maintenance and whole life costs. High strength durability Combine low oxygen permeability and low water porosity with high compressive and flexural strength, and you have a flooring solution that is designed to last.

ASSURANCE FAQs TOPFLOOR provides superior flexural and compressive strength. Why choose TOPFLOOR over steelreinforced concrete? TOPFLOOR is fast to lay and load, costeffective with reduced maintenance and material costs and more sustainable reducing CO 2 emissions by up to 20%. How long does it last? TOPFLOOR is highly durable, requires no surface treatment and has a high abrasion resistance achieving BS-8204: part 2 2002. How does it reduce shrinkage and cracking? Due to TOPFLOOR S mix design technology conventional concrete shrinkage of 550-880 micro metres per metre is reduced to 250-350 micro metres per metre with TOPFLOOR. What are the sustainability benefits? Compared to traditional steel mesh or steel fibre reinforced concrete, TOPFLOOR reduces CO 2 emissions by up to 20%. How much time can be saved? TOPFLOOR can be placed fast using conventional laserscreed methods. Time is also saved through early power-trowelling and joint cutting, while slab loading can begin at just 14 days.
